We’ve stayed 3 or 4 times at Excelsior, and, as last visit, had a wonderful time. The setting is amazing, Kirstin who runs it is lovely, very efficient and an amazing cook! James who is maitre d’, is also very personable and helpful. Both of them make sure your stay is top class. There’s a golf buggy you can use to look round the vineyard. The wine is very good indeed, and guests get to drink it free, whether lounging round the beautiful pool or enjoying one of Kirstin’s wonderful dinners. We will go back and would definitely recommend it.

Had a fab 2 night stay at this beautiful wine farm. Dinner was very good with as much wine as you liked included. The pool is big with beautiful views of vines and mountains. Had a couple of walks in the mornings accompanied by the farms sheep dogs which was great. Very relaxing stay, lots of wine farms close by, short drive in to Robertson, great food also at GRAZE right next to the farm dam. The bedroom was small but we did have our own small sitting room as well and also a lovely stoop outside with further sofa’s to relax on. Really good breakfast, pastries, fruits, cold meat and cheese etc also a cooked breafast to order.

The evening meal was really good and the hotel grounds were nicely kept but otherwise this hotel was a bit of a disappointment. Nobody seemed to be managing it. We would have liked to relax by the pool, but with just 12 recliners for 18 guests that was not possible. Air con in the room was ineffective. Breakfast service was under-manned, uncleared tables, and flies feasting on the cold buffet.
